Logg på med Microsoft
Logg på, eller opprett en konto.
Hei,
Velg en annen konto.
Du har flere kontoer
Velg kontoen du vil logge på med.

Symptomer

Anta at du installerer Microsoft SQL Server-2016 på en datamaskin som har .NET Framework installert 4.6.1. Hvis datamaskinen ikke har installert .NET Framework 3.5, fungerer funksjonen databasen post ikke på riktig måte. For eksempel hvis du konfigurerer og send en test-e-postmelding, meldingen står i kø, men aldri blir sendt.

Obs! Dette problemet påvirker også forekomster som kjører SQL Server 2016 SP1 CU1. Dette problemet oppstår på grunn av en feil i installasjonen av SQL Server 2016 SP1 CU1. Installasjonsprogrammet for SQL Server 2016 SP1 CU1 sletter konfigurasjonsfilen DatabaseMail.exe.config uten å erstatte den med en ny. Dette fører til at e-post Database å bryte i fravær av .net framework 3.5 SP1. Feilrettingen i SQL Server 2016 SP1 CU2 er ment å løse dette problemet og forhindre at filen DatabaseMail.exe.config komme slettes fra datamaskinen når du har installert et klipp. Så hvis du installerer SQL Server 2016 SP1 + CU2, berøres e-post Database ikke av oppsettet. Hvis e-post Database er ødelagt av installasjonen av SQL Server 2016 SP1 CU1, kan du bruke én av de midlertidige løsningene som er nevnt nedenfor.

Løsning

Dette problemet ble løst i følgende kumulative oppdateringer for SQL Server:

    Samleoppdatering 2 for SQL Server 2016 SP1

Samleoppdatering 2 for SQLServer 2016

Hver nye kumulative oppdateringen for SQL Server inneholder alle hurtigreparasjonene og alle sikkerhetsreparasjoner som fulgte med den forrige kumulative oppdateringen. Sjekk ut de nyeste kumulative oppdateringene for SQL Server:


Nyeste kumulative oppdateringen for SQL Server-2016

Løsning

Hvis du vil omgå dette problemet, kan du implementere en av følgende:

  1. Opprette DatabaseMail.exe.config og slipp den ved siden av DatabaseMail.exe under mappen Binn . Du kan bruke notepad.exe eller et annet redigeringsprogram for å redigere den. Pass på at du lagrer den ved hjelp av UTF-8-koding (i notepad.exe, velg Lagre som... og i kombinasjonsboksen koding , velg UTF-8):

         <?xml version="1.0" encoding="utf-8" ?>          <configuration>          <startup useLegacyV2RuntimeActivationPolicy="true">           <supportedRuntime version="v4.0"/>               <supportedRuntime version="v2.0.50727"/>          </startup>          </configuration>
  1. Kjør installasjonsprogrammet reparasjonen av SQL Server-2016 SP1.

  2. Manuelt installere .net Framework 3.5 på maskinen.

Status

Microsoft har bekreftet at dette er et problem i Microsoft-produktene som er oppført i delen "Gjelder for".

Referanser

Lær mer om terminologien som Microsoft bruker til å beskrive oppdateringer av programvare.

Trenger du mer hjelp?

Vil du ha flere alternativer?

Utforsk abonnementsfordeler, bla gjennom opplæringskurs, finn ut hvordan du sikrer enheten og mer.

Fellesskap hjelper deg med å stille og svare på spørsmål, gi tilbakemelding og høre fra eksperter med stor kunnskap.

Var denne informasjonen nyttig?

Hvor fornøyd er du med språkkvaliteten?
Hva påvirket opplevelsen din?
Når du trykker på Send inn, blir tilbakemeldingen brukt til å forbedre Microsoft-produkter og -tjenester. IT-administratoren kan samle inn disse dataene. Personvernerklæring.

Takk for tilbakemeldingen!

×